Grasping Concrete Sealers
Concrete sealers serve as essential to safeguarding cement areas from harm caused by water, spots, and environmental factors. They form a barrier on the surface that stops water infiltration, which can result in breaks and decline over time. By applying a quality sealer, you can greatly extend the longevity of your cement and maintain its appearance.
There are different types of concrete sealers available, all designed for particular purposes. A few are film-forming, which indicates they create a protective layer on the top, while others are absorbing, enabling the sealer to soak into the concrete for deeper protection. Choosing the right kind is determined by the surroundings the cement is exposed to and the desired look, such as glossy finishes versus natural appearances.
Proper application of cement sealants is essential for achieving the optimal results. This includes preparing the surface, ensuring it is clean and dry, and applying the sealer evenly following the producer’s instructions. Typical Mistakes in Concrete Sealing
One of the most common errors in cement sealing is putting on the sealer prematurely after placing the concrete. It is essential to permit the concrete to cure adequately, typically for at least 28 days, before sealing. Applying the sealant too early can entrap moisture inside the cement, leading to issues like bubbling or peeling of the sealer. This can undermine the integrity of the area and negate the advantages you anticipate from the sealant application.
A different frequent error is neglecting to prepare the area adequately prior to applying the sealer. Concrete should be clear, dry, and free of any dirt, oil, or coatings. Omitting this critical step can result in poor adhesion of the sealer, leading to an uneven surface or areas of the area that remain unsealed. A proper clean-up and prep process guarantees that the sealer forms a solid bond with the concrete.
Finally, many people overlook the importance of using the right kind of sealant for their specific requirements. There are various types of sealants available, including penetrating sealants, surface-protecting sealers, and aesthetic sealers. Using the wrong type can result in insufficient protection or an undesirable look. It is essential to comprehend the features of various sealers and select one that aligns with the intended use and environmental conditions of the cement surface.
Suggestions for Effective Concrete Coating
To obtain the optimal results with concrete sealing, proper surface preparation is essential. Commence by thoroughly washing the concrete surface to remove any dirt, oil, or existing coatings. A high-pressure washer can be useful in ensuring the surface is clear of contaminants. Let the surface to dry completely before applying any sealant. This preparatory step will enhance adhesion and ensure the sealant infiltrates effectively into the concrete.
Selecting the appropriate type of sealant is equally important. Consider the specific needs of your project, such as the location of the concrete and the level of exposure levels to weather elements. For instance, outdoor surfaces may require a different sealant that offers ultraviolet protection and water resistance compared to inside applications. Always follow the manufacturer’s recommendations regarding application techniques and drying times to ensure optimal performance.
Ultimately, regularly inspect sealed concrete surfaces and maintain them properly to increase the life of the sealant. Look for signs of damage or damage, and apply again sealant as needed, especially in high-traffic areas. Periodic cleaning using a mild detergent and water can help maintain the surface and prolong the duration of the seal. Regular care will ensure that your concrete surfaces remain protected and aesthetically pleasing over time.
